Sprig Rally Racer

The Rally Racer is fun on wheels with Adventure Guide ‘Rudi Tootin’ on board, to help drive imaginative play. When a child rolls the Dune Buggy forward, it triggers the generator that fuels the lights and motor sounds and with no batteries needed, the fun is endless.
By harnessing natural kinetic energy, the pump powered revving action brings the lights and sounds to life. Kids are rewarded for their efforts with engaging lights and sounds, fueling their imaginations and encouraging them to play longer.
Sprig Toys always feature the exclusive SprigWood, composed of recycled plastics and wood. It makes use of reclaimed products such as PP (Polypropylene), saw dust, rice husk, and palm fiber, while featuring a real wood smell.
All SprigWood toys are safe and tested. They are BPE, PVC, and phthalate free. Ages 3+.

What Canadian Parents are saying…

We loved that this little car only had two pieces- the Rally racer and the cute little wooden guy Rudi, my little guy kept calling him Woody though! It is very rugged, and the wheels are soft rubber so you don’t need to worry about it creating scratches on your floors. You’ll notice that Sprig also uses old computer parts as the connector for Rudi to attach to the car is actually a mini-USB connector! My husband thought that was pretty neat. The other cool thing is when you pump the back of the Racer, Rudi’s helmet light starts to shine! No batteries needed for this either, a definite plus!
